1. Loan Options and Strategies to Manage Student Debt
Federal Student Loans
The primary financial aid source for most students is federal student loans, which generally offer favorable interest rates and flexible repayment options. For undergraduates, the Federal Direct Subsidized and Unsubsidized Loans are typical choices. Subsidized loans do not accrue interest while you are in school at least half-time, making them a cost-effective option. Unsubsidized loans accrue interest from disbursement, so it's advisable to pay interest during school if possible.
Private Student Loans
Private loans are an alternative for students who need additional funding beyond federal options. These are provided by banks or credit institutions and often come with higher interest rates and less flexible repayment terms. It is advisable to exhaust federal aid options before considering private loans.
Strategies for Managing Student Debt
To effectively manage student debt, students should consider:
- Borrow only what is necessary to cover tuition and essential expenses.
- Explore scholarships, grants, and work-study options to reduce reliance on loans.
- Maintain a budget during and after school to ensure timely repayment.
- Understand repayment plans such as Income-Driven Repayment (IDR), which adjusts payments based on income, providing flexibility.
- Consider loan forgiveness programs, especially if working in underserved areas or public service sectors.
2. Program Overview and What Students Will Study
Program Description
The Clinical/Medical Laboratory Science/Research and Allied Professions program at UAB prepares students to become skilled professionals in laboratory medicine, research, and related healthcare fields. This program emphasizes practical skills, scientific knowledge, and research capabilities necessary for modern clinical laboratories.
Curriculum Highlights
Students will study a comprehensive curriculum that includes human anatomy and physiology, microbiology, hematology, clinical chemistry, immunology, molecular diagnostics, and laboratory management. Practical laboratory coursework and clinical rotations are integral components, providing hands-on experience essential for professional competency.
Learning Outcomes
Graduates will be equipped to perform complex laboratory tests, analyze results accurately, and contribute to diagnostic decisions. They will also develop critical thinking, problem-solving, and communication skills necessary for collaborative healthcare environments.
3. Career Opportunities and Job Prospects
Typical Career Paths
Graduates of this program are highly sought after in various healthcare and research settings, including:
- Medical laboratories in hospitals and clinics
- Research institutions and biotech companies
- Public health laboratories
- Pharmaceutical companies
- Veterinary laboratories and environmental testing
Job Titles
Common roles include Medical Laboratory Technologist, Clinical Laboratory Scientist, Research Laboratory Technician, and Laboratory Supervisor. Many graduates advance into supervisory, managerial, or specialized diagnostic roles with experience and additional certifications.
Job Outlook
The demand for clinical laboratory professionals is expected to grow steadily, driven by an aging population, technological advancements, and expanded healthcare services. The median salary varies by position and location but generally offers competitive compensation relative to the educational investment.
